Attractions and Places To See around Ellenville - Top 19

Best attractions and places to see around Ellenville include a diverse range of natural landscapes and cultural sites. Nestled at the foot of the Shawangunk Ridge in Ulster County, New York, the village offers access to expansive preserves and historical landmarks. The area features natural wonders like lakes and waterfalls, alongside cultural points of interest such as museums and historic districts. It serves as a hub for outdoor activities and exploring regional history.

Awosting Falls

Highlight • Waterfall

Awosting Falls is a beautiful place to stop and enjoy being out in nature. The falls are about 60 feet high and set amongst a dramatic cliff.

Note that it can get quite busy here as it is only approximately 10 minutes walk from a car park.

Frequently Asked Questions

What natural features and viewpoints can I explore around Ellenville?

Ellenville is surrounded by stunning natural beauty. You can visit Lake Minnewaska, nestled between cliffs and trees, perfect for swimming and hiking. Don't miss the dramatic Rainbow Falls and the 60-foot Awosting Falls. For panoramic views, head to Millbrook Mountain or the unique clifftop trail at Gertrude's Nose. Sam's Point Preserve also offers sweeping views and the fascinating Ellenville Fault-Ice Caves.

Are there any historical or cultural sites to visit in Ellenville?

Yes, Ellenville has a rich history. Explore the Ellenville Fault-Ice Caves within Sam's Point Preserve, which contain the largest known exposed fault system in the United States. You can also delve into the region's past at the Catskills Borscht Belt Museum, or visit the Ellenville Public Library & Museum (Terwilliger House Museum) to see local historical artifacts. The Ellenville Downtown Historic District showcases diverse architectural styles from the 19th and early 20th centuries.

Are there family-friendly attractions or activities in Ellenville?

Absolutely! Many natural attractions are suitable for families. Lake Minnewaska is great for swimming and easy walks. Awosting Falls is easily accessible from a car park, making it a good option for families with small children. Lippman Park offers mountain bike trails, and the Bob Mangels Botanical Gardens and Berme Road Park provide serene settings for walks and enjoying nature.

Where can I find unique local experiences or shops in Ellenville?

For a taste of local history and flavor, visit Cohen's Bakery, a downtown staple known for its unique raisin pumpernickel bread and other baked goods. You can also catch a professional theater production at Shadowland Stages, housed in a beautifully restored 1920s Art Deco cinema. The Ellenville Downtown Historic District itself is great for a stroll to admire the architecture and local shops.

What are the best places for hiking and enjoying scenic views?

For hiking and breathtaking views, Minnewaska State Park Preserve is a must-visit. The trail to Gertrude's Nose offers stunning clifftop vistas. Millbrook Mountain provides panoramic views of the Catskills. Sam's Point Preserve also boasts sweeping views of the Catskills and Rondout Valley from its highest point on the Shawangunk Ridge.

Can I find any unique geological formations or waterfalls?

Yes, Ellenville is home to several unique geological features and waterfalls. The Ellenville Fault-Ice Caves at Sam's Point Preserve are a significant geological site. For waterfalls, you can see the dramatic Rainbow Falls and the impressive Awosting Falls, both within Minnewaska State Park Preserve. Hanging Rock Falls and Nevele Falls (also known as Buttermilk Falls) are also notable cascades in the area.

What is the best time to visit Ellenville for outdoor activities?

The best time to visit Ellenville for outdoor activities largely depends on what you want to do. Spring and fall offer pleasant temperatures for hiking and cycling, with vibrant foliage in autumn. Waterfalls like Rainbow Falls are best viewed after heavy rain or snowmelt in spring. Summer is ideal for swimming in Lake Minnewaska, while winter offers opportunities for snowshoeing and cross-country skiing.

Are there any dog-friendly trails or attractions?

Many of the outdoor areas around Ellenville are dog-friendly, but it's always best to check specific park regulations before you go. Minnewaska State Park Preserve generally allows dogs on leash on carriage roads, but often not on footpaths or in swimming areas. Sam's Point Preserve also has specific rules for pets. Always ensure your dog is leashed and you clean up after them.

What are some lesser-known or 'hidden gem' attractions?

Beyond the main highlights, consider exploring Cragsmoor, a historic and natural attraction offering spectacular views, historical buildings, and a rich art history. The Shawangunk Mountains Scenic Byway offers a gorgeous route for a scenic drive, revealing many hidden spots. For a unique experience, you might even spot one of the three copies of 'The Boy with the Leaking Boot' statues scattered around Ellenville.
